Web27. apr 2012. · At 28, long jumper Shameka Marshall is training for her last shot at the Olympics. Her attempts to make the team in 2004 and 2008 didn't work out, so this year, she's working hard toward the U.S. track and field team trials in June. Just 5-foot-2, Marshall also coaches track and field at Temple University in Philadelphia.
